Output 61a3cacc3fea292a607068f4f153453604b65ac663ea663e5e754aa0873c20ef:26
- value
 - 8513208
 - script pubkey
 - OP_0 OP_PUSHBYTES_20 bf1ec58edce493f886169bacb033bbe18ac9954a
 - address
 - bc1qhu0vtrkuujfl3psknwktqvamux9vn922a4cvxn
 - transaction
 - 61a3cacc3fea292a607068f4f153453604b65ac663ea663e5e754aa0873c20ef
 - confirmations
 - 265297
 - spent
 - true